Are dreads dirty?

Dreadlocks are only dirty if you don't take care of them and wash them. Not washing dreadlocks is the best way to ruin dreadlocks. You should wash your dreadlocks at least once a week.

How much do dreads cost?

Going to a professional for dread installation can cost as little as $200 and upwards of $800. Some locticians charge a base fee however more often than not I've seen that they charge by the hour, the dreading method, your hair length, and/or your hair type.

What is the meaning of dreadlocks?

The followers of this movement called themselves "Dreads," signifying that they had a dread, fear, or respect for God. Emulating Hindu and Nazarite holymen, these "Dreads" grew matted locks of hair, which would become known to the world as "Dreadlocks" – the hair-style of the Dreads. … But the term "Dreadlocks" stuck.

Are dreadlocks permanent?

Locks are locked until they aren't. Although dreadlocks are mainly seen as a permanent hairdo that can only be undone by cutting your hair, many hair salons are now offering to undo their client's dreadlocks in a variety of ways.
